Do I need to tell you that there are minor surgical procedures that are done in the treatment rooms of clinics and in the A$E without the need to take the patient to the theatre? So if you want to remove a small growth on the leg, you wouldn't do it until you use the theatre? So, you are telling me all surgical procedures are done in the theatre? Please, you need to be well informed doctor. Dentists that remove people's teeth while the patient is awake but experiences no pain, do they do it in the theatre or in their clinics? Or that is not a surgical procedure? Dermatologists that remove melanocytic naevus, skin tags and other small skin growths in their treatment rooms in their clinics nkor? If you go to the A$E of many hospitals, repair of minor lacerations are done there in the A$E without taking the patient to the theatre. That is not a surgical procedure? If you want to do incision and drainage for a small abscess, you will be waiting to take the patient to the theatre?

It's called LIPOMA. : A lipoma is a round or oval-shaped lump of tissue that grows just beneath the skin. It's made of fat, moves easily when you touch it and doesn't usually cause pain. Lipomas can appear anywhere on the body, but they're most common on the back, trunk (torso), arms, shoulders and neck. it can be remove via a surgery.

No treatment is usually necessary for a lipoma. However, if the lipoma bothers you, is painful or is growing, your doctor might recommend that it be removed. Lipoma treatments include: Surgical removal.
